How is Gorilla trekking in Nkuringo Sector. Gorilla trekking in the Nkuringo sector of Bwindi Impenetrable National Park is a unique and exhilarating experience that attracts adventure seekers and wildlife enthusiasts alike. This area is renowned for its stunning landscapes, diverse wildlife, and intimate encounters with mountain gorillas. Here’s a detailed overview of what to expect when trekking in Nkuringo:

1. Challenging Terrain

The Nkuringo sector is known for its steep hills and rugged paths, which make trekking here more physically demanding than in other parts of Bwindi. Hikers may need to climb several steep slopes, traversing through dense forests filled with various flora and fauna. Although the trek can be strenuous, the reward of encountering gorillas in their natural habitat makes every step worthwhile.

2. Fewer Tourists

One of the most appealing aspects of trekking in Nkuringo is the lower number of visitors compared to other sectors like Buhoma or Ruhija. This leads to a more personal and immersive experience, allowing trekkers to enjoy their time with the gorillas without the crowds. The Nkuringo sector is home to several habituated gorilla families, such as the famous Nkuringo group and the Bushaho group, providing a variety of interactions.

3. Stunning Scenery

The Nkuringo sector offers some of the most breathtaking views in Uganda. As trekkers make their way through the forest, they are rewarded with panoramic vistas of the surrounding mountains, valleys, and the iconic Virunga Volcanoes. The mist-covered landscapes create a magical atmosphere that enhances the trekking experience.

4. Cultural Immersion

Visitors to Nkuringo have the opportunity to engage with local communities, particularly the Batwa people, who have lived in and around the forests for centuries. Cultural experiences can include visits to traditional villages, where travelers can learn about the Batwa’s history, traditions, and their deep connection to the forest. This cultural aspect enriches the overall gorilla trekking experience.

5. Conservation Efforts

Gorilla trekking in Nkuringo plays a vital role in conservation. The fees from trekking permits, which are around $800 USD, contribute directly to gorilla conservation and local community development. This funding helps protect the gorillas and their habitat while supporting initiatives that benefit local residents.

6. Biodiversity and Wildlife

Aside from mountain gorillas, Bwindi Impenetrable National Park is rich in biodiversity, hosting over 350 bird species, various primates, and other wildlife. The Nkuringo sector is particularly attractive to birdwatchers, with the chance to spot rare species like the African green broadbill and numerous butterflies. The lush forest is also home to other wildlife, including forest elephants and various monkeys, adding to the thrill of the trek.

7. Accessibility

The Nkuringo sector is accessible from Kisoro, a town located about an hour’s drive away. Visitors can also reach it via the Kihihi airstrip, which is closer to the southern sectors of Bwindi. Although the Nkuringo sector is more remote, the journey through scenic landscapes and rural areas is part of the adventure.
